处理器架构(CPU架构)及指令集

处理器架构(CPU架构)及指令集

请添加图片描述
中央处理器: 又称CPU,全称为Central Processing Unit。是一块超大规模的集成电路,是一台计算机的运算核心和控制核心,即Core And Control Unit。它的功能时解释计算机指令(执行)以及处理计算机的数据等。

CPU的结构:中央处理器由三个部分构成,分别是运算器、控制器、寄存器

关于计算机结构的知识展开讲恐怕得将一本书,在这里仅简单介绍每个单元的功能作用,便于前期理解即可。
请添加图片描述

这三个部分通过总线连接起来

控制单元(控制器): 负责将程序指令转化成硬件电路中的实际动作,比如打开某个加法或者减法器等。类似于一个解码工具,其收到某条程序指令后,会按预先设定好的顺序依次适当的运算电路(使用了运算器)

运算单元(运算器): 其内包含着各种运算器,负责将来自存储单元的数据沿着控制单元划定的路径去进行计算并将计算结果送回存储单元。

存储单元(寄存器): CPU与外部进行数据交换的场所,也负责运算数据的缓存。

指令集: 一个预先设定好的流程手册。对于由程序转化而来的不同指令,控制单元会执行不同的预设操作,就好比是一个预设的对照手册,外部传来要完成某个动作的指令,而这个指令可能由不同的基本运算构成,那么控制单元会根据这个预设的对照手册去寻找这个动作的基本构成运算元素,并按照手册上的预设顺序去依次执行,以此最终完成这个动作要求。

微架构: 指令集中的指令在处理器中的执行方法,个人理解即执行指令集中的每条指令所对应的每个硬件操作方法。

请添加图片描述

指令集的形象理解
不同架构类型的CPU有着不同的指令集,目前主流的中央处理器微架构有:

X86微架构: 英特尔和AMD的“专属”,在PC市场上独霸多年,地位不可撼动。主要面向家用、商用等领域,在性能和兼容性方面较好。唯其属于复杂指令集架构。

ARM微架构: 在移动端和便捷设备上有着不可替代的优势。在节能和能效方面较好。

MIPS微架构: 在网关、机顶盒等领域很流行。

RISC-V微架构: 刚出来的架构,在智能穿戴等产品的应用上非常广泛,前景广阔。

指令集类型: 依照现阶段的主流体系结构来讲,指令集可分为精简指令集和复杂指令集两种。

精简指令集: 又称RISC,全称为 Reduced Instruction Set Computer。其仅包括一些常用的指令,遇到更复杂的指令可通过简单指令的复合搭配而实现出来。

复杂指令集: 又称CISC,全称为 Complex Instruction Set Computer。除了一些简单的指令以外,还含有一些不常用的指令动作,这些不常用的指令动作通常是简单指令的顺序排序集合。
(以上为个人理解整理,如有错位感谢留言赐教)

  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值